
Honey Roasted Heirloom Potatoes
Total Time
Prep: 15 min. Bake: 35 min.
Yield
6 servings
They are colorful, salty and sweet! These are a yummy spin on the typical mashed potatoes that take a spot at the holiday table. They are versatile and delicious with a main course of spiral sliced ham, turkey or beef roast. —Linda Povlock, Hampstead, Maryland
Ingredients
- 2 lbs. fingerling potatoes, halved lengthwise
- 1/4 cup finely chopped onion
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 2 garlic cloves, minced
- 2 teaspoons ground mustard
- 1 teaspoon dried parsley flakes
- 2 teaspoons sea salt
- 1/2 teaspoon coarsely ground pepper
- Additional honey, optional
Directions
- Preheat oven to 375°. Place potatoes in a greased 15x10x1-in. baking pan. In a small bowl, combine next 8 ingredients. Pour over potatoes; toss to coat. Bake, uncovered, until golden and tender, 35-40 minutes, stirring potatoes once halfway through cooking. If desired, drizzle potatoes with additional honey.
Nutrition Facts
1 cup: 225 calories, 7g fat (1g saturated fat), 0 cholesterol, 659mg sodium, 37g carbohydrate (8g sugars, 3g fiber), 4g protein.
